    Laravel Htmx

    Laravel htmx is a package that provides a nice way of working with htmx, a library that allows you to access modern browser features directly from HTML. The package outlines features such as Htmx Request, Htmx Response, and rendering Blade fragments with htmx.

    PHP 8.3 is released with typed class constants, a json_validate function, and more

    PHP 8.3 has been released with new features including typed class constants, the json_validate() function, and dynamic constant fetch.

    MongoDB Laravel Integration Now Officially Supported

    MongoDB has officially taken over development of the community-driven MongoDB integration for Laravel framework, offering Eloquent models, query builders, and transactions for PHP developers. The latest release supports Laravel 10.
